The vulnerability, officially indexed as CVE-2025-54494, is a stack-based buffer overflow that potentially allows an attacker to execute arbitrary code. The <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ameeba.com\/blog\/cve-2025-55444-severe-sql-injection-vulnerability-in-online-artwork-and-fine-arts-mca-project-1-0\/\"  data-wpil-monitor-id=\"76710\">severity of this vulnerability<\/a> is high, as it can potentially lead to a full system compromise or data leakage if successfully exploited.
